What exactly is Boba Protein Powder?
Before we get into the specifics, let’s first understand what Protein Powder is all about. Boba, often known as bubble tea or pearl milk tea, is a popular Taiwanese beverage. It is often a sweet, tea-based beverage with chewy tapioca pearls at the bottom.
This delectable mixture has enchanted taste buds all around the world, and it’s now making an unexpected and healthy reappearance in the shape of protein powder.
Powder is a unique combination of protein-rich ingredients, frequently inspired by the flavors of famous Boba cocktails. It provides a tasty way to savor the essence of Boba while also providing your body with the protein it needs for muscle recovery, growth, and overall well-being.

How Do You Eat Boba Protein Powder?
Now that you’re interested in Boba Protein Powder, here are some recommendations for getting the most out of it:
Pick Your Flavor:
Choose your favorite Boba flavor or try new ones to keep your taste buds stimulated.
Inventive Mixing:
For a creamy and tasty protein shake, combine Boba Protein Powder with almond milk, coconut water, or even yogurt. For the true Boba cold, add additional ice.
Boba Protein Balls as a snack:
Make protein balls blended with Boba flavors to be creative. These are a nice, protein-rich snack.
Including in Recipes:
Boba Protein Powder can be used in baking or cooking to add a distinctive twist to recipes. Boba-infused pancakes, muffins, or even protein-rich Boba-flavored oatmeal are all options.
